2008-08-07 Peter Stephenson <pws@csr.com>
|
||||
|
||||
* 25415: README, Doc/Zsh/builtins.yo, Doc/Zsh/func.yo,
|
||||
Doc/Zsh/options.yo, Src/builtin.c, Src/exec.c, Src/init.c,
|
||||
Src/options.c, Src/signals.c, Src/zsh.h, Test/A05execution.ztst,
|
||||
Test/C03traps.ztst: Make DEBUG_BEFORE_CMD the default;
|
||||
make ERR_EXIT ineffective in DEBUG traps but allow it to
|
||||
be set to skip the next command (actually sublist); tidy
|
||||
up code associated with trapreturn.

@ -1060,6 +1060,13 @@ item(tt(ERR_EXIT) (tt(-e), ksh: tt(-e)))(
|
|||
If a command has a non-zero exit status, execute the tt(ZERR)
|
||||
trap, if set, and exit. This is disabled while running initialization
|
||||
scripts.
|
||||
|
||||
The behaviour is also disabled inside tt(DEBUG) traps. In this
|
||||
case the option is handled specially: it is unset on entry to
|
||||
the trap. If the option tt(DEBUG_BEFORE_CMD) is set,
|
||||
as it is by default, and the option tt(ERR_EXIT) is found to have been set
|
||||
on exit, then the command for which the tt(DEBUG) trap is being executed is
|
||||
skipped. The option is restored after the trap exits.

Debug traps (`trap ... DEBUG' or the function TRAPDEBUG) now run by default
|
||||
before the command to which they refer instead of after. This is almost
|
||||
always the right behaviour for the intended purpose of debugging and is
|
||||
consistent with recent versions of other shells. The option
|
||||
DEBUG_BEFORE_CMD can be unset to revert to the previous behaviour.
